DAZZLING EYRE PENINSULA From the sandy dunes of the Head of Bight and the salt pans of the Gawler Ranges to the pristine coastline, the Eyre Peninsula offers a kaleidoscope of experiences. Enjoy them all on Intrepid Travel’s nine-day Eyre Peninsula Adventure, where you can marvel at the otherworldly colours of Lake Macdonnell, feast on freshly-shucked oysters in Coffin Bay, and enjoy some whale spotting from the area’s imposing limestone cliffs. 3. SAIL THE WHITSUNDAYS If you like to do more on your holidays than lie on a beach, Life’s An Adventure’s seven-day Whitsundays Sail and Walk trip could be what you’re looking for. Beginning and ending in Airlie Beach, this trip takes you sailing through the Whitsunday Islands on a tall ship, stopping to hike some of the most scenic landscapes including the rainforests and eucalypt forests of South Molle Island. 4. CYCLE THE HIGH COUNTRY In the mood for a gourmet getaway that also keeps you active? The Tour de Vines three-day Murray to Mountains Rail Trail guided cycling group tour in alpine country Victoria is a weekend away with a difference. The scenic itinerary departing from Beechworth has you visiting some of the area’s best farm gates and cellar doors, and the gentle grade means you never have to break a sweat.
